1.1Introduction
Offshoreandgasexplorationandproductionismovingintowaterdepthsgreater than3000m,whicharechallengingthewell-establisheddesignsandpipesused. Pipesfortheseapplicationsareexposedtohighcollapsepressure,tohighaxial loads,andpartlytofatigueinthegirthwelds.Intheearly1960s,mediumcarbon steelwasthematerialusedinlinepipeindustry.Thetechnologicaldevelopmentin weldingprocesses,useofmicroalloying elementinsteel,and thermomechanical controlprocess(TMCP)haveenabledtheindustryinproducinghigh-strengthsteels, thereforemovingtolow-carbonsteelswithhighstrengthaswellasweldability. Thishasfurtherhelpedinreducingthespecificsteelconsumptioninoilandgas transportation.Thecurrentfocusonlesswallthicknessatstrengthlevelleadstothe useofX80andX100gradesofsteel[1–4].
MechanicalandcorrosionpropertiesofAPIX70areimprovedbytheadditionof alloyingandcontrolofparametersonTMCP,suchassoakingtemperature,rolling temperature,finishingtemperature,coolingrate,andcoolinginterrupttemperature [5–15].Sulfidestresscracking(SSC)isakindofhydrogen-relatedproblemof linepipesteelsfortransportationofcrudeoilandnaturalgascontaininghydrogen sulfide.Thedemandforhigh-strengthsteelforlinepipewithsourgasresistance hasincreased.Manufacturingthiskindofsteelpiperequiresastrictsteel-making practiceandacontrolledthermomechanicalschedulewithanadditionalaccelerated coolingprocedure.ItiswellknownthattheAPIX70steelissusceptibletocorrosion insolutionscontainingNaClandH2 S[16–19].Hydrogenuptakedecreasesthe tensilepropertiessuchasyieldstrength,ultimatestrength,andelongation[20] andcausescrackingknownashydrogen-inducedcracking(HIC).Withtheaimof improvingSSCresistanceofAPIX70steel,varioustechniquesduringsteel-making processesarerequiredsuchasadditionofproperalloyingelements,microstructure control,highcleanness,andCatreatment[1, 9–11, 21–24].
Amongvarioustypesofmicrostructure,acicularferritehasbeenknownasthe optimummicrostructurewhichhasexcellentcombinationofhighstrengthand goodtoughness,mainlyduetoitsrelativelyhighdensityofdislocationsandfinegrainednature[25–28].However,judiciousselectionofmicroalloyingelementsand optimizationofprocessparametersisessentialtoobtaintherequiredmicrostructure [29].Thecoarseferritegrainsandtherelativelylowdislocationdensityenhanced hydrogenbuildupinthestress-concentratedzoneaheadofthecracktip,facilitating decohesionandcrackingofparticlesinthiszone[30, 31].Therefore,mostof theAPIX70toX100gradeslinepipesteelsutilizetheacicularferritestructure toobtainthebalancedpropertiesrequiredforlinepipeapplications.However, acicularferriteinlinepipesteelsnucleatedmainlyatnucleationsitesofdislocation substructureswithindeformedaustenitegrain,unlikethebainite,whichnucleatedat grainboundaryofaustenite.Increasedacicularferritecontentinthemicrostructure improvedHICresistanceandSSCresistance,whilebainiteandmartensite/austenite constituentsareharmfulfortheresistanceinsourenvironments[14, 32].Thesteels withafine-grained,bainite-ferritestructurepossessamuchbettercombination
ofstrengthandSCCresistancethanthosewithaferrite C pearlitestructure.An increaseinthepearlitecontentinthemicrostructurehasadetrimentaleffectonthe SCCresistanceoflinepipesteelswithaferrite C pearlitestructure[33].
Becauseishasgreaterrequirementsforweldinghigh-strengthsteels,suchasX80 andX100,itproposedtoobtainasteelofequalorhigherstrengththanX80froman APIX70steelbyapplyinganonconventionalheattreatmentinordertoachievethe acicularferrite-dominatedmicrostructure.
1.2Experimental
ThematerialusedinthepresentstudywasAPI5LX70pipewithanoutside diameterof740mmandawallthicknessof11.35mm.Thechemicalcomposition ofthissteelisshowninTable 1.1.Specimensof 70 mm 150 mmwereheat-treated at1050 ı Cfor30minandcooledinwaterorair.Heat-treatedandas-receivedplates weremachinedindogboneshapeaccordingtoASTMA370[34]fortensiletesting. ImpacttestwithCharpyV-notchspecimens(CVN 10 mm 10 mm 55 mm)was carriedoutat0 ı CaccordingtoASTME23[35].
Microhardnessmeasurementswereconductedintheas-receivedsteelandin theheat-treatedsamples.Theas-receivedsteelwasetchedfor15sin2.5%nital. Microstructuralanalysiswascarried outbyoptical(OM)andscanningelectron microscopy(SEM).
1.3ResultsandDiscussion
Figure 1.1 showsthemicrostructureoftheAPIX70steelinthedifferentconditions: as-received,nonconventionalheat-treatedwater-cooled,andheat-treatedair-cooled. Intheas-receivedmaterial,Fig. 1.1ashowsamicrostructurecharacterizedby polygonalferritegrains(F)andperlitebands(P),typicalofthistypeofsteel.
Figure 1.1bshowsamicrostructurecomposed offineacicularferrite(AF)and bainite(B)whichwastheresultofthenonconventionalheattreatmentwhenthe samplewascooledrapidlywithwater.
ThistypeofmicrostructureispreferredtoreducethesusceptibilitytoSCC,as reportedbyreferences[32, 33].Figure 1.1crevealsthatwhenthesteelwascooled

moreslowly,themicrostructureissimilartotheoneobtainedbyanormalizing heattreatment:polygonalferriteandperliteareaswithlongergrainsizethanthe as-receivedmaterial.
Figure 1.2 showsthestress-straincurvesobtainedfromAPIX70withand withoutheattreatment.Tensilepropertiesandimpactresultsaresummarizedin Table 1.2 alongwithimpactresults.
Theresultsobtainedbytensiletestsshowthatheattreatmentwithwatercoolingleadstohighertensilestrengthasisreportedby[1–4].Althoughductility decreased,ithasbeenreportedthatthemicrostructureofacicularferriteandbainite obtainedwiththenonconventionalheattreatmentisresistanttoSCC[33]butnot forsourenvironments[14, 32].Accordingtotheliterature,fortheimpacttest, theminimumimpactenergyrequirementsforadesignfactorof0.625is48J [36];inthepresentwork,itwas60Jofenergyabsorbed.Inthefracturesurfaces analyzedbySEM,itisevidentthatbothspecimensexhibitedakindofductile fracture,sincetheyshowedmicro-plasticdeformation,nucleation,andcoalescence ofmicrovoidsaroundnonmetallicinclusions(Fig. 1.3a).Theseinclusionswere

ThelimitsofhardnessrecommendedforavoidingSSCareintherangeof20–30 HRC(240–250Hv),butthe22HRCanditsequivalentintheotherhardnessscale isthemorecommonreportedbythestandard[36].Althoughthelimitsofhardness arenotalwaysaneffectiveguidefortheselectionofmaterial,theselimitsarethe morecommonrequirementsfortheline-pipesinsourservice.Theresultsofthe hardnessmeasurementsobtainedarepresentedinFig. 1.4.Hardnessobtainedfrom heat-treatedwater-cooledsamplesincreasedinarangeof280–310Hv.Fortheroom temperature-cooledspecimen,thehardnessdecreasedfrom180to200Hv,andfor theas-receivedspecimen,itshardnesswas200–220Hv.

1.4Conclusions
HeattreatmentappliedtoanAPI5LX70pipesteelto1050 ı Cfor30minfollowing water-coolingyieldsacicularferriteandbainitemicrostructurewithmechanical strength250MPahigherthanas-receivedsteel.Althoughhardnessincreasedwith heat-treating,theaveragevalueisbelowthepermissiblelimitforservice.Theresults obtainedwiththenonconventionalheattreatmentyieldsimilarpropertiesasAPI 5LX120steel.However,thehighhardnessofthissteelpreventsitsusewithsour hydrocarbons.Thefindingsofthisstudyimplythatispossibletoreducethewall thicknessoflinepipestotransportsweetcrudeoil.

Abstract TwoconcentrationsofNPE-4nonionicsurfactantandcorrosioninhibitor (CI)commerciallyavailablewereaddedtoNaCl(2.45%and3%)andoceanwater solutions(OWS)inordertostudythecorrosionprocessofAPIX52pipeline steel.CorrosioninhibitionofX52pipelinesteelinchloridesolutionswasevaluated byusingelectrochemicalimpedancespectroscopy(EIS)andpotentiodynamic polarizationcurves.EISanalysesshowedthat3%NaClwasthemorecorrosive solutionforX52steel.AddingCIto3%NaClsolutionimprovesthecorrosion resistanceofX52steel;however,addingCItoOWS,thecorrosioncontrolofX52 steelwasmoreevidentpreventingthepitting,saltsembedding,andcorrosionunder deposits.X52steelexposuretosolutionsaddingsurfactantascorrosioninhibitor afterhavingbeenevaluatedthroughpolarizationcurvesdisplayedlowcorrosion rates(0.88mm/year).Standardfreeenergycalculationsuggestedthatsurfactantis adsorbedphysicallyintotheX52steelsurface.Meanwhile,itwasobservedthatCI wasmoredifficulttoadsorbonX52steelsurface,andconsequentlycorrosionwas higherthanaddingsurfactanttochloridesolutions.

2.1Introduction
Inoilindustry,theinternalcleaningofpipelinesiscarriedoutusingacidenvironmentlikeinhibitedHCl[1–4].Thistypeofsolutioniswidelyrecommendedas thecheapestwaytodissolvedepositofcarbonatecompoundsinsidethepipelines andincludesasurfactantthatactsasanadditivecapableofinhibitingthecorrosive effectofHCl.Migahedetal.studiedtheinhibitionprocessofinternalcorrosion ofpipelinesusingnonionicsurfactantsinthepresenceof1MHClsolution[1].

Migahed’sworkssuggestedthatsurfactantsactasgoodcorrosioninhibitorsusing lowconcentrationsandtheadsorptionofsurfactantmoleculesonsteelincreases withincreasingthetensioactivemolecularsizethanforhighconcentrationsand lowmolecularsize.Anotherworkevaluatedthecorrosioninhibitionofmildsteel usingnonionicsurfactantsinthepresenceof0.05MNaClsolutionwithrotating cylinderelectrodeat1000rpm[5].Thisworkreportedthatthesurfactantisadsorbed onmetalsurfacesactingasacorrosioninhibitor.However,theinhibitoryaction dependssignificantlyfromthecriticalmicellarconcentration(CMC)[6, 7].Another studycharacterizedtheprotectiveeffectofcationicsurfactantsoncarbonsteel surfacesinthepresenceof1MHCl[8].
Theresultsofthisstudyrevealedthattherealandimaginaryimpedanceresponse washigherwithincreasingthedosageofsurfactant.However,theelectricaldouble layercapacitancevalueshavenegativeeffectswhenthesurfactantconcentration isincreased,duetotheadsorptionofsurfactantmoleculesonmetalsurface.Itis importanttomentionthatothers’worksconsideredtheuseofanionic,cationic,and nonioniccompoundsthatinhibitthesteelcorrosionprocessinacidsolutions[9–12]. Moreover,theoilrecoveryinMéxicoiseverytimemoredifficultduetoheavyand extra-heavypetroleumproduction.Inaddition,thedepositedsediment,solids,and saltsdissolvedcanprovoketheincreaseoftheviscosityinthepetroleum.
Theproductionofheavyandextra-heavyoilpresentsimportantchallengesthat requiresignificanttechnologicaldevelopmentsintheoilindustry.Also,thehigh viscosityofthepetroleumcanprovokecorrosionbyerosion.Itiswellknown thatsurfactantsareusedforreducingtheviscosityintheheavyandextra-heavy petroleum[13, 14].Thus,thesurfactantdosageintoheavypetroleumisableto improveitsfluidityandeasytransportation.Inthisway,thechemicalpropertiesof nonionicNPE-4surfactanthavebeenappliedinheavyandextra-heavypetroleum production[13].Accordingtopreviouslydescribed,theelectrochemicalstudyof surfactantsanditsinhibitorypropertiesincontactwithsalts,likechloridesolutions orcarbonatecompoundsthatarefoundinsidethepipelineduringtheheavyand extra-heavypetroleumproductionandcanberelatedtotheembeddingorcorrosion underdepositsgeneratedontheinternalpipelinesurface,isofgreatinterest.
Inthepresentwork,inhibitionofX52pipelinesteelcorrosioninthepresence ofoceanwaterandtwoconcentrationsofNaClsolutionsaswellastwodosagesof nonionicNPE-4surfactantandcorrosioninhibitor(CI)commerciallyavailablewas studied.Tocarryoutthisstudy,theelectrochemicalimpedancespectroscopy(EIS) andpotentiodynamicpolarizationcurveswereproposedbecauseofitsusefulness andtherewasconsiderationtostudythecorrosionprocessinshorttime.First,the EIScharacterizationofthepipelinesteelwasperformedinanaqueoussolution mainlycomposedofoceanwatersolution(OWS)andtwoconcentrationsofNaCl asablank.EISanalysiswascarriedoutusingequivalentcircuits,whereitispossible todiscussthemodificationsoftheEISdiagramswiththepresenceofdifferent stepsoccurringsimultaneously.Basedonpolarizationcurves,theadsorptionand inhibitionpropertieswereevaluated.Theelectrochemicalbehaviorwasrelatedto themodificationofthestepsinvolvedinthecorrosionprocessofthepipelinesteel inthechloridesolutions,obtaininggoodinhibitorypropertiesforthesurfactant.
2.2Experimental
2.2.1SteelUsed(Electrode)
ArodfromX52pipelinesteelwith0.5cm2 ofexposurearealikeworkingelectrode (WE)wasused.Rodgraphiteasanauxiliaryelectrode(AE)andasaturatedcalomel electrode(SCE)asareferenceelectrodewereused.Inallmetalliccoupons(WE), theexposedsurfaceswerepreparedbymechanicalgrindingwithupto600-grit water-cooledSiCpaperssoastoobtainareproduciblesurfaceandsubsequently cleanedinanultrasonicbathfor1mininacetone.Nominalchemicalcomposition ofX52pipelinesteelisshowninTable 2.1
2.2.2TestSolutions
TheNaClcorrosivesolutionstestswerepreparedasfollow:2.45gand3.0gofNaCl wereweighedanddissolvedin1000mLofdeionizedwater.OWSwasprepared accordingtoASTMD1141standard[15].Fortheelectrochemicalevaluation, aconstantvolumeof100mLofeachblankwasused.Theformerdissolution ofnonionicsurfactantandCIcommerciallyavailablewaspreparedinisopropyl alcoholtoreach30,000mg/L(solutionA).Inthisway,solutionAwasusedto prepare30and60mg/Lofeachmolecule.Theelectronicstructure,mesoscopic simulations,andanalyticalcharacterizationofNPE-4moleculewerereportedin previouswork[13].
2.2.3ElectrochemicalEvaluations
Allelectrochemicalcharacterizationswerecarriedout inanelectrochemicalcell withthree-electrodearrangement.Electrochemicaltestingwasperformedina potentiostat-galvanostatAUTOLABmodelPGSTAT30atopen-circuitpotential (OCP).TheEIStestswereobtainedusing10mVofperturbationand10kHzto 10mHzoffrequencyafter1hofexposureofworkingelectrodeat30ı Cand600rpm inthecorrosivesolutions.Potentiodynamicpolarizationcurvesweremeasuredby potentialscanningfrom ˙300 mVvs.OCPatasweeprateof1mV/s.

2.3ResultsandDiscussion
2.3.1Electrode
TheelectrodesusedintheelectrochemicalevaluationsweremachinedfromAPI X52pipelinesteel.Thissteelhasthemicrostructuretypicaloflow-carbonsteels, whichconsistedofperlite(darkgrains)andferrite.Theaveragegrainsizeinthis steelwasaround10–20 masisshowninFig. 2.1.Low-carbonsteelstendtohave aferrite-perlitestructurecontaining littleperliteinthegrainboundaries mainly.
2.3.2ElectrochemicalImpedanceSpectroscopy(EIS)
NyquistplotsforX52steelexposedtothethreesolutionsareshowninFig. 2.2. Significantchangestowardlowrealandimaginaryimpedancevaluesareobserved intheprofileobtainedin3%NaCl.Meanwhile,OWSshowedanincreasein impedancevalues.Inaddition,thepresenceofinductiveloopatlowfrequencies isobtainedinallelectrolytes.
Recently,itwasreportedthattheinductivebehaviorcanberelatedtothe adsorptionoftheneutralizingamineson1018steelsurface[16].Inthepresentstudy, thisbehaviorisassociatedwiththepittingcorrosionandmetallicdissolutionofX52 pipelinesteelbychlorideenvironments.Asafirstapproachforfittingtheimpedance diagramsshowninFig. 2.2,aRandlesequivalentcircuitwasusedomittingthe

inductiveresponseandusingBoukampprogram[17].Thisequivalentcircuitis relatedtothecorrosionmechanismoccurringatthedifferentinterfacesinvolving solutionresistance(Rs ),corrosionproductproperties(Rcp and Ccp ),chargetransfer resistanceassociatedwithX52steeloxidation(Rct ),andcapacitancecontributionof theelectricaldoublelayer(Cedl )onX52steel/chloridesolutioninterfaceasisshown inTable 2.2.Thecapacitancevalueswereevaluatedfromconstantphaseelement (CPE: Qi ,specifically Y0i ),usingtheequationreportedinpreviouswork[18].
Theionicconductivityofthechloridesolutionsintheabsenceofsurfactant andCIissimilar(Rs 10 cm2 ).Ithadbeenestablishedthatanincreaseinthe pseudocapacitancevaluescanberelatedwiththedecreaseofresistanceproperties andtheformationofironoxideswithaporousandnon-protectivenatureonthe metalsurface[19].Inthismanner,thepseudocapacitancevalues(C )obtainedfor 3%NaClcanberelatedtotheformationofmoreactiveironoxidesonX52steel surfacethanX52exposedto2.45%NaClandOWS.Thisbehaviorisinagreement withthequalitativeanalysisofNyquistdiagramsshowedinFig. 2.2.Besides,itcan becorroboratedthattheporousnatureofthecorrosionproductsformedontheX52 steelinchloridesolutionsgiven n values(n < 1).The Ecorr valuesforeachsystem wereasfollows: 0:610 Vvs.SCEfor3%NaCl, 569 Vvs.SCEfor2.45%NaCl, and 0:567 Vvs.SCEforOWScorroboratingthat3%NaClsolutionwasmore activetothecorrosionprocess.
